“Again, again!” are the words children often squeal when they hear their favorite stories. My grandma Patty told me stories of her childhood that I never tired of hearing. Encouragement from family and friends and my love of the 1940s time period inspired me to write this novella. May these vignettes remind you of the favorite storyteller in your life. Peggy Poe is an adventurous Midwestern girl growing up on a farm in Southern Indiana during the 1940s. Many of the joys and sorrows she and her family experience are as timeless and universal as storytelling itself.
